Introduction

Infant daycare became a typical choice for numerous moms and dads in the current society. Utilizing the increasing range dual-income homes and single-parent families, the need for trustworthy and top-notch childcare for babies is much more predominant than ever before. In this essay, we are going to explore the advantages and difficulties of baby daycare, including its affect child development, socialization, and parental well being.

Advantages of Toddler Daycare

One of the main benefits of infant daycare may be the chance for young ones to socialize with regards to peers while very young. Research has shown that younger babies just who attend daycare have actually better social abilities and so are prone to form secure attachments with adults also children. This very early experience of social communications often helps babies develop important social and psychological skills which will benefit them in their resides.

Besides socialization, baby daycare also can provide a safe and stimulating environment for children to understand and develop. Numerous daycare facilities offer age-appropriate activities and educational possibilities that can help babies develop cognitive, engine, and language skills. By doing these tasks on a daily basis, babies can attain important developmental milestones faster and effortlessly than when they were acquainted with a parent or caregiver.

Moreover, infant daycare may also be very theraputic for parents. For a lot of doing work parents, daycare provides a dependable and convenient choice for childcare enabling all of them to focus on their particular jobs while realizing that their child is within great fingers. This satisfaction decrease parental anxiety and stress, enabling moms and dads become much more effective and engaged in their particular work.

Difficulties of Toddler Daycare

Inspite of the many benefits of baby Daycare Near Me By State, there are additionally difficulties that parents and providers must consider. One of many major difficulties is the prospect of split anxiety in babies who are not accustomed becoming from their particular primary caregiver. This may result in stress and emotional upheaval for the kid therefore the parent, making the transition to daycare problematic for everyone else included.

Another challenge of baby daycare could be the potential for exposure to illness. Young babies have establishing resistant methods that are not yet totally prepared to address the germs and viruses being common in daycare options. This will probably induce regular conditions and missed times of work for parents, also increased tension and worry about their child's wellness.

Additionally, the cost of infant daycare may be prohibitive for several households. The high price of quality childcare is a substantial monetary burden, especially for low-income families or those with several children. This could result in difficult decisions about whether or not to register a child in daycare or for one parent to remain house and forgo potential income.
